What is Agent Skills Hub?
Agent Skills Hub is a curated registry that turns public repository signals, permission context, install guidance, and editorial review into searchable pages. It accepts MCP server and Claude Code skill metadata from GitHub and outputs security-graded listings with installation instructions and workflow-fit analysis. The platform runs as a web directory and is maintained by an independent team (no company name stated on the page).
Key Features
- Security grading (A–F) — Every skill is scanned for 45+ attack vectors including arbitrary code execution, API key leakage, and unbounded file access before it appears in search results.
- 1213+ total skills — Covers official MCP servers, OpenClaw skills, and community-contributed tools across categories like development, e-commerce, finance, and marketing.
- OpenClaw Skills Leaderboard — Ranked by "heat score" (community adoption + security audit score) from 2,993 cleaned skills; includes install counts and star ratings.
- Trending picks and scenario pages — Weekly editor-curated top skills, plus dedicated guides for browser automation, MCP discovery, and agent workflow libraries.
- Value-added guides — Separate landing pages for "Agent Skills Hub", "Cursor Skills Hub", "MCP Agent Skills", and "Skills Library for Agents" to give search engines targeted citation targets instead of routing all queries through the homepage.
- Vulnerability intelligence — Public threat intelligence table showing real vulnerability patterns detected in the registry (e.g., RCE, credential leaks, path traversal).

How does it work?
- Browse the skill directory via search or category filters.
- Review each skill's security grade, permission scope, source evidence, and install path on its detail page.
- Use the provided installation guidance (often MCP JSON config or CLI commands) to add the skill to your agent environment.
- For premium verification, submit a skill for manual static analysis ($99 audit) to receive a "VERIFIED SECURE" badge and priority routing in the directory.
Pricing
Agent Skills Hub is free to browse and use — all listed skills are accessible without payment. A premium security audit and verification badge costs $99 per skill and includes manual static analysis plus a security certificate.
